What to Look For (Decision Criteria)
When evaluating insurance verification systems for complex fleet operations, standard status checks are inadequate. Decision-makers must demand comprehensive coverage analysis. The API must go beyond active or inactive status to retrieve specific coverage limits and parse exact details, such as the Vehicle Identification Number (VIN), to ensure the physical asset is fully protected. Without parsing these nuances, a policy might be active but lack the necessary protection for the specific vehicle in use.
Business use detection is another critical requirement. Personal policies often contain business use prohibited clauses that immediately void coverage when a vehicle is used commercially. The verification system must automatically identify and flag these exclusions to prevent deploying uninsured drivers. Without this capability, fleet operators assume the liability of underinsured contractors.
Carrier-sourced data accuracy is essential for eliminating fraud and administrative errors. The chosen solution should bypass optical character recognition (OCR) and document parsing, which are inherently prone to error and cannot guarantee real-time authenticity. Instead, platforms must prioritize direct API connections to carrier systems for live, authentic data retrieval.
Finally, seamless integration is necessary for transforming operational workflows. The API must integrate smoothly into existing fleet or loan management systems without disrupting operations. This enables the programmatic retrieval of a driver's auto policy status and coverage details precisely when it is needed, such as prior to closing a deal or onboarding a new driver.
